Date Application Received: 7/20/2015 �O�O <br /> Date Application Considered as Complete:7/30/2015 <br /> 60-Day Review Period Expires: 9/30/2015 <br /> To: Chair Leskinen and Planning Commission Members y�'� �� <br /> Jessica Loftus, City Administrator qkESHO�� <br /> From: Jeremy Barnhart, Community Development Director <br /> Date: August 17, 2015 <br /> Subject: #15-3768, Michael and Lisa Larson, Ordinance amendment related to dog <br /> boarding and grooming in B-1 zoning district, Public Hearing <br /> Application Summary: The applicants are requesting a text amendment that would allow dog <br /> grooming and boarding in the Retail Sales (B-1) zoning district. <br /> Staff Recommendation: Planning Department Staff recommends approval of the ordinance as <br /> proposed. <br /> List of Attachments <br /> Exhibit PC-A Application <br /> Exhibit PC-B Proposed Ordinance <br /> Exhibit PC-C Staff option <br /> Exhibit PC-D B-1 Zoning areas <br /> Exhibit PC-E B-1 Zoning District permitted and Conditional Uses <br /> Background <br /> Michael and Lisa Larson plan to open a dog boarding, day care, and grooming facility at 3596 <br /> Shoreline Drive. The property is zoned B-1 Retail Sales; those uses are not permitted. <br /> To facilitate their business,the applicants propose an amendment that defines their business <br /> and allows it by conditional use permit in the B-1 zoning district. The applicants feel that their <br /> proposed business is appropriate in the B-1 zoning district, given the proximity to public <br /> highways,the required setbacks of the district and the intensity of their use compared to other <br /> uses of the district. <br /> The B-1 zoning district provides locations for a wide range of retail and service businesses <br /> adjacent to highways and public sanitary sewer. The majority of B-1 zones are in the Navarre <br /> area. <br />
